This international Contact-Making Seminar brings together youth workers, facilitators, coordinators, and active young people involved in Erasmus+ projects who want to build strong partnerships and meaningful international cooperation.
Through participatory workshops, simulations, and peer-to-peer exchange, participants will share experiences, reflect on challenges in international teamwork, and explore how cultural differences and communication styles shape collaboration. The seminar focuses on turning diversity and tensions into opportunities for learning, trust-building, and co-creation of future projects.
Moreover, the seminar creates a shared space for connection, exchange, and the development of future Erasmus+ project ideas.
